A Step-by-Step Guide: How to Create an E-commerce Website

In today’s digital age, having an e-commerce website is essential for businesses to reach a wider customer base and drive sales. Building an e-commerce website may seem like a daunting task, but with the right approach and tools, you can create a successful online store. In this blog, we will walk you through the step-by-step process of creating an e-commerce website.

Define your goals and plan your website

Before diving into the technical aspects, it’s crucial to have a clear understanding of your goals and objectives. Determine the products or services you want to sell and identify your target audience. Research your competitors and study their successful strategies. This information will guide you in making informed decisions throughout the website development process.

Choose a domain name and hosting provider

Selecting a domain name is an important step as it represents your brand identity. Choose a name that is relevant to your business and easy to remember. Next, find a reliable hosting provider that offers e-commerce functionality and supports popular CMS platforms which have the factors like server reliability, security, and scalability.

Select an e-commerce platform or CMS

Based on your technical expertise and requirements, choose an e-commerce platform or CMS that aligns with your business needs.

Set up product catalog and payment gateways

Create a product catalog by organizing your products into categories and subcategories. Include detailed descriptions, pricing information, and high-resolution images for each product. Set up a secure payment gateway to facilitate smooth and secure transactions. Popular payment gateways include PayPal, Stripe, and Authorize.net. Remember to implement SSL encryption to ensure customer data security.

Enable shopping cart and checkout process

Integrate a shopping cart feature that allows customers to add products, review their selections, and proceed to checkout seamlessly. Streamline the checkout process by minimizing the number of steps required to complete a purchase. Offer multiple payment options, guest checkout, and a secure way to store customer information for future purchases.

Implement shipping and order management

Two delivery women cooperating while checking data on the packages in the office.

Determine your shipping options and configure shipping rules based on factors like weight, location, and delivery services. Integrate shipping carriers such as FedEx, UPS, or USPS to provide real-time shipping rates to your customers. Implement an order management system to track and manage orders efficiently.

Ensure website security and performance

Implement robust security measures to protect customer data and prevent fraud. Regularly update your platform and plugins to the latest versions to patch security vulnerabilities. Use SSL certificates to encrypt sensitive information transmitted between your website and customers. Optimize website performance by optimizing images, using caching techniques, and choosing a reliable hosting provider.

Test, launch, and promote your website

Before launching your website, thoroughly test its functionality, usability, and responsiveness across different devices and browsers. Ensure all links, forms, and payment gateways are working correctly, Once you’re satisfied.

Leave a Comment

Your email address will not be published. Required fields are marked *

Easy Video Reviews

{{trans(`You have no camera installed on your device or the device is currently being used by other application`)}}
{{trans(`Please try visiting this page with a valid SSL certificate`)}}
{{trans(`You can record up to %s minutes, don't worry you will review your video before sending`, time(preference.max_video_length))}}
{{trans(`You can record up to %s minutes, don't worry you will review your video before sending`, time(preference.limits))}}
{{trans('Uploading video...')}}

{{trans('Upload video')}}

{{trans('Drag your files here or click in this area')}}
{{uploader.file}} {{uploader.size}} x